Analysis

The most recent figure for employment to population ratio, 15+, total (%) in Sweden is 59.0%, measured in 2025.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.5% on the previous year and down 0.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, employment to population ratio, 15+, total (%) in Sweden peaked at 64.1% in 1991 and was at its lowest, 56.2%, in 1997.

Sweden ranks 82nd of 186 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

Employment to population ratio, 15+, total (%) in Sweden, year by year

Annual values for Employment to population ratio, 15+, total (%) (modeled ILO estimate) in Sweden, 1991 to 2025.
Year Value Change
1991 64.1%
1992 61.2% -4.6%
1993 57.5% -6.0%
1994 56.7% -1.4%
1995 57.6% +1.6%
1996 57.0% -1.1%
1997 56.2% -1.4%
1998 56.5% +0.6%
1999 57.8% +2.3%
2000 58.6% +1.3%
2001 59.7% +1.9%
2002 59.5% -0.3%
2003 59.2% -0.6%
2004 58.2% -1.6%
2005 58.3% +0.1%
2006 58.9% +1.0%
2007 59.8% +1.6%
2008 59.9% +0.2%
2009 58.1% -3.0%
2010 57.8% -0.5%
2011 58.6% +1.4%
2012 58.5% -0.2%
2013 58.7% +0.4%
2014 58.8% +0.2%
2015 59.2% +0.6%
2016 59.6% +0.7%
2017 60.1% +0.8%
2018 60.4% +0.5%
2019 60.2% -0.4%
2020 58.8% -2.2%
2021 58.5% -0.5%
2022 59.8% +2.1%
2023 60.0% +0.4%
2024 59.3% -1.2%
2025 59.0% -0.5%
